DOOM Confirmed 1080p 60 FPS On PS4 and Xbox One

Bethesda has confirmed that this year's DOOM release will run at 1080p with 60FPS on both the Xbox One and PS4. It sees this achievement as a showcase of the technology behind the idTech 6 engine that powers the game.

Among the other information shared on Bethesda's latest blog post is the reveal of the Static Cannon and Vortex Rifle for multiplayer as well as confirmation that the United Aerospace Corporation is back.

Below is the latest campaign gameplay trailer of DOOM, featuring raw PC version footage. 

DOOM will debt on May 13th for Xbox One, PS4, and PC.
